Having reviewed the logs, it is clear that I was doing something dumb in trying to install grub on /dev/sda1 (a partition) instead of /dev/sda (my first hard disk) (See last line of comment #3).
However, I would still expect the installer to handle this gracefully, without crashing, so this bug still stands.
